Классика баз данных - статьи

       

в следующем релизе будут использоваться


Наконец, в следующем релизе будут использоваться методы обучения для запоминания селективности обрабатывавшихся ранее предикатов и использования этих данных в будущем.

В SQL Server используются гистограммы maxdiff со значениями к качестве параметра разделения и, по существу, средней частоты (в каждом бакете) в качестве параметра источника []. Допускается до 199 бакетов, и внутри каждого бакета сохраняются частота максимального значения и (по существу) накопленная частота всех меньших значений. Гистограммы обычно конструируются на основе взятия образцов данных. Составные индексы используются в той же манере, что и в других системах, для получения многомерной информации о селективности.

Заметим, что во всех коммерческих СУБД реализуются строго одномерные гистограммы. За исключением применения некоторой второстепенной косвенной информации, в системах по-прежнему используется предположение о независимости значений атрибутов, и не используются многомерные гистограммы.


Содержание  Назад  Вперед